The Mechanics of Dead or Alive 2

So I was spinning on deadoralive2 the other night, and man, this slot’s mechanics are just wild. High volatility is the name of the game here, which means you gotta have some serious bankroll management to keep your head above water. RTP is around 96.8%, which isn’t bad at all, but with the volatility cranked up, I found myself hitting some dry spells that felt like an eternity. What I love about this slot is how it plays into that high-risk, high-reward mentality. You get those wilds and sticky features going during the free spins, and that’s when you can really rack up some serious cash – if you’re lucky enough to hit a good run. But let’s be real; sometimes it feels like the slot gods just aren’t on your side, right? I’ve spent sessions where it just keeps eating my bets like it’s got a bottomless pit for a stomach.

Now let’s talk bonus buys because that’s where things get interesting. I mean, sure, some people are against them due to the higher wagering requirements involved, but honestly? Sometimes you just gotta take that plunge for the thrill of it! The Dead or Alive 2 bonus buy option lets you dive straight into those free spins without waiting for the reels to be kind – but it can be a bit pricey. It’s all about weighing your options though; do you wanna risk a chunk of your bankroll for a chance at those sweet payouts? Or do you wanna play it safe and try to build up slowly? Personally, I’ve had mixed results with bonus buys – one minute I’m cashing out big wins and then next thing I know I’m staring at my dwindling balance thinking “What was I thinking?” Classic gambler dilemma.
